Why Our SWOT Analysis Tool is Important
Strategic Clarity
In the fast-paced worlds of architecture and interior design, knowing exactly where you stand is crucial. Our tool helps you:
- Identify Strengths: Highlight your unique design skills, innovative approaches, and solid client relationships.
- Pinpoint Weaknesses: Understand the areas where your project or business could improve—be it in workflow efficiency, resource limitations, or market reach.
- Spot Opportunities: Recognize emerging trends such as sustainable design, virtual consultations, and new market niches.
- Anticipate Threats: Prepare for external challenges like increased competition, economic downturns, and regulatory changes.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is a SWOT Analysis?
A: A SWOT analysis is a strategic planning tool used to identify and evaluate the internal strengths and weaknesses, as well as the external opportunities and threats, related to your project or business.
Q2: Why is a SWOT Analysis important for architects and interior designers?
A: It provides a clear framework for assessing your design projects or business strategies, helping you manage risks, capitalize on opportunities, and stay competitive in a fast-evolving industry.

Q6: How often should I perform a SWOT analysis using this tool?
A: We recommend conducting a SWOT analysis at the start of a new project, at key milestones during project execution, and as part of your annual strategic review. This ensures your plans remain aligned with current trends and market conditions.
